<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><span class="gmail-m-7599957739598646180heading1char"><span style="font-size:16.0pt">CSLP</span></span><b>
<br>
The 5 winners have been named for the 2021 CSLP Teen Video Challenge!</b> <br>
This national contest from the Collaborative Summer Library Program encouraged teens to create 60-second public service type videos that promote reading and library use to other teens, and interpret the CSLP theme of Tails and Tales. These videos show the amount
 of talent, creativity, and thoughtfulness that went into all of this year's submissions. You can see the winning videos here:<br>
<a href="https://gcc02.safelinks.protection.outlook.com/?url=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.cslpreads.org%2F2021-teen-video-challenge-winners%2F&data=04%7C01%7CLancasterC5%40michigan.gov%7C91eca3bf46f5443f1dc908d9a2d18fd9%7Cd5fb7087377742ad966a892ef47225d1%7C0%7C0%7C637719843227770078%7CUnknown%7CTWFpbGZsb3d8eyJWIjoiMC4wLjAwMDAiLCJQIjoiV2luMzIiLCJBTiI6Ik1haWwiLCJXVCI6Mn0%3D%7C1000&sdata=w8fAma%2Fx3d3t5gNUN8WJFaHIfDZtK7PTsgXB6hF5Z%2BI%3D&reserved=0" target="_blank">https://www.cslpreads.org/2021-teen-video-challenge-winners/</a><br>
They are fun, creative, and inspiring! The winning teens/teen teams each received a $200 cash prize from CSLP.<br>
Libraries are welcome to use any/all of the winning videos to help promote their summer program, reading, and library use in general. A shout out to New York: 4 of the 5 winning videos came from New York!! The fifth winner is out of Florida. Another shout out
 goes to the wonderful judging panel that made very difficult decisions to narrow down so many excellent, creative entries to these 5 winners! And special thanks to Luke Kralik of CSLP, who wrangled forms, updated the website, participated in the judging panel,
 sent out prizes, and more to make this contest happen again. <o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to">2021 will be the last year for this long-running contest. CSLP will be looking for ideas to engage with teens across the country during the summer in fresh new ways (have ideas?
 Please send 'em our way!). Many thanks to all of you that promoted this contest in your state and community! <o:p></o:p></p>
<h1>Ready to Read Michigan Presents: <o:p></o:p></h1>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b><span style="font-size:12.0pt"><a href="https://gcc02.safelinks.protection.outlook.com/?url=https%3A%2F%2Flibraryofmichigan.app.neoncrm.com%2Fnp%2Fclients%2Flibraryofmichigan%2Fevent.jsp%3Fevent%3D2165&data=04%7C01%7CLancasterC5%40michigan.gov%7C91eca3bf46f5443f1dc908d9a2d18fd9%7Cd5fb7087377742ad966a892ef47225d1%7C0%7C0%7C637719843227770078%7CUnknown%7CTWFpbGZsb3d8eyJWIjoiMC4wLjAwMDAiLCJQIjoiV2luMzIiLCJBTiI6Ik1haWwiLCJXVCI6Mn0%3D%7C1000&sdata=6Hn1WQ7KA6E4POR5AIden5fG9ZT0mQCdQqlGKgz6FlM%3D&reserved=0" target="_blank">Reimaging
 School Readiness</a></span></b><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b><span style="font-size:12.0pt">January 20<sup>th</sup> and 27<sup>th</sup>, 2022<br>
1:00 PM – 3:00 PM ET</span></b><span style="font-size:12.0pt"><br>
Please plan to join us <u>live </u>for this 2-part series, offered by the Bay Area Discovery Museum, created to introduce librarians to the research, practical implications, and resources offered in their Reimagining School Readiness toolkit.</span><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><span style="font-size:12.0pt">Research shows that beliefs about intelligence and ability impact one's performance and response to failure. Learn more about what research says,
 how to examine and change your own mindset, and what you can do to help support children's growth mindset and persistence through challenge.</span><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><span style="font-size:12.0pt">Do you wonder what research really says about how to support school readiness? Based on a comprehensive review of cognitive and developmental psychology,
 the key findings in Reimagining School Readiness aim to surface the skills and conditions that matter most for a child's success in school and life, and to guide educators and others (including families) in designing learning experiences and environments to
 support this development.</span><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><span style="font-size:12.0pt">Attendees will gain insights into the current research behind the skills and conditions that matter most for a child's success in school and life.
 The workshop will include an overview of BADM's Reimagining School Readiness Toolkit that library staff can use to supplement or create quality school readiness programming.</span><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><span style="font-size:12.0pt">Instructor: Michelle Wessman Randall, PhD, Head of Evaluation at the Bay Area Discovery Museum (BADM) and BADM staff.</span><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><i>This project is made possible by grant funds from the U.S. Institute of Museum and Library Services (IMLS) administered by the State of Michigan through the Library of Michigan.</i><o:p></o:p></p>

<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b>Early Literacy Calendar</b><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to">Now available in English AND Spanish, PLA's
<a href="https://gcc02.safelinks.protection.outlook.com/?url=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.alastore.ala.org%2FPLA2022ceng&data=04%7C01%7CLancasterC5%40michigan.gov%7C91eca3bf46f5443f1dc908d9a2d18fd9%7Cd5fb7087377742ad966a892ef47225d1%7C0%7C0%7C637719843227780035%7CUnknown%7CTWFpbGZsb3d8eyJWIjoiMC4wLjAwMDAiLCJQIjoiV2luMzIiLCJBTiI6Ik1haWwiLCJXVCI6Mn0%3D%7C1000&sdata=QXlegnz4KAvQRLtisxBzWLVEccaognU8jSUhSNfPhco%3D&reserved=0" target="_blank">
2022 Early Literacy Calendar</a> helps your library's patrons engage in early literacy activities all year long! Based on the Every Child Ready to Read® practices of reading, writing, singing, talking, playing (and now counting), each download contains twelve
 months of learning activities, book lists, nursery rhymes, and more! On one side is a calendar with a fun skills-building activity for each day and the other contains supplementary content like nursery rhymes, early literacy tips, song lyrics, or suggested
 reading material. The calendar pages are also customizable with each containing a designated spot to add your library’s logo and contact information.<o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b>Cost:</b> $23.99/PLA Members | $26.99/ALA Members | $29.99/Others<o:p></o:p></p>

<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b><a href="https://gcc02.safelinks.protection.outlook.com/?url=https%3A%2F%2Fngcproject.org%2Fngcp-anniversary-fellowship-program&data=04%7C01%7CLancasterC5%40michigan.gov%7C91eca3bf46f5443f1dc908d9a2d18fd9%7Cd5fb7087377742ad966a892ef47225d1%7C0%7C0%7C637719843227799947%7CUnknown%7CTWFpbGZsb3d8eyJWIjoiMC4wLjAwMDAiLCJQIjoiV2luMzIiLCJBTiI6Ik1haWwiLCJXVCI6Mn0%3D%7C1000&sdata=1Tn%2BPuT0OYJNwZoQQggC6Kk6dspvCkQTkOZ9n5068vc%3D&reserved=0" target="_blank">NGCP
 Anniversary Fellows Program</a></b><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b>National Girls Collaborative Project (NGCP)</b> is celebrating its 20th Anniversary in 2022. As part of our anniversary celebrations, we are offering a remote-based, nine-month
 professional development program open to early career professionals, and graduate students, interested in gender equity and informal STEM education. Fellows will contribute to NGCP’s ongoing STEM and equity projects and will have diverse opportunities to learn
 and collaborate with the NGCP national network. Fellows will also participate in advanced training on gender equity and cultural responsiveness and receive ongoing mentorship and support.
<b>Application deadline is November 23, 2021. </b><o:p></o:p></p>

<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b><a href="https://gcc02.safelinks.protection.outlook.com/?url=https%3A%2F%2Fhome.edweb.net%2Fwebinar%2Fcommonsense20211111%2F&data=04%7C01%7CLancasterC5%40michigan.gov%7C91eca3bf46f5443f1dc908d9a2d18fd9%7Cd5fb7087377742ad966a892ef47225d1%7C0%7C0%7C637719843227809903%7CUnknown%7CTWFpbGZsb3d8eyJWIjoiMC4wLjAwMDAiLCJQIjoiV2luMzIiLCJBTiI6Ik1haWwiLCJXVCI6Mn0%3D%7C1000&sdata=p4bZB7AgWknuJx3NOJT%2F1GHCnCphbp89Tow9fflOEpg%3D&reserved=0" target="_blank">Strategies
 for News Literacy in Today’s Divided Culture</a></b><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b>Thursday, November 11</b><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to"><b>3:00 PM ET</b><o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to">This edWebinar will help educators navigate the world of news and media by engaging in strong relationships with students and providing them with reliable skills and habits.<o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to">K.C. Boyd is a Washington, D.C. librarian and News Literacy Project ambassador preparing students with essential skills in the midst of Black Lives Matter, the January 6th insurrection,
 and vaccine misinformation. K.C. will share how she teaches students the importance of watching local and national news, and how to identify misinformation in their news feeds by using the following teaching strategies:<o:p></o:p></p>
<ul type="disc">
<li class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to;mso-list:l0 level1 lfo1">
Active teacher listening: Teachers can better understand the student experience and moderate tough conversations<o:p></o:p></li><li class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to;mso-list:l0 level1 lfo1">
Finding student-friendly news sources: Identify trusted resources with journalistic integrity, but also meet students where they’re at on social media<o:p></o:p></li><li class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to;mso-list:l0 level1 lfo1">
Engaging in civics: Highlight ways for students to be informed about their world, understand their options, and take a stand for what they believe in<o:p></o:p></li></ul>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to">K.C. will demonstrate activities and share takeaway resources that will allow attendees to replicate her strategies with their own students.<o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="mso-margin-top-alt:auto;mso-margin-bottom-alt:auto">This edWebinar will be of interest to school and district leaders, teachers, and librarians of middle and high school levels. There will be time for questions at the end of the
 presentation.<o:p></o:p></p>
